Budget
Basic refresh: paint, new flooring (LVP), shelf installation above washer/dryer, and updated lighting. No plumbing, no cabinet installation, no major electrical work.
Mid-Range
Full functional upgrade: new flooring, painted walls, upper cabinet installation, a utility sink with new supply and drain lines, a folding counter, updated lighting, and a new GFI outlet. Includes minor plumbing work to add or relocate the utility sink.
Premium
High-end laundry room with custom cabinetry, quartz countertop, tile flooring, a built-in laundry sink with premium faucet, new recessed lighting, updated plumbing and electrical, pull-out hamper drawers, and a hanging rod system.
Material Options
Material prices below are national averages; availability in Portland may shift costs slightly.
| Material | Cost/Unit |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Basic Refresh (Paint and Flooring) | $500-$1,500 | Rentals, homes being prepped for sale, tight budgetsLowest cost and effort; significant visual improvement |
| Utility Sink + Upper Cabinets | $2,000-$4,500 | Main functional upgrade for most homeownersAdds most-wanted functional features; high daily use value |
| Full Cabinet System with Folding Counter | $3,000-$7,000 | Families with high laundry volume or homeowners who want a functional utility roomMaximum storage and workspace; organized, clean look |
| Tile Flooring | $5-$15/sq ft installed | Laundry rooms with frequent water splashing or in-floor washer drain pansBest water resistance; easy to clean; durable for utility spaces |
| LVP Flooring | $3-$7/sq ft installed | Most residential laundry rooms; best value for moneyWater resistant, warm look, DIY-friendly installation, comfortable underfoot |
